As the Copa Libertadores group stage reaches its climax, Rosario Central and Caracas FC are set for a crucial encounter at the Estadio Gigante de Arroyito.

This match is pivotal for both teams, with their hopes of advancing to the knockout stages hanging in the balance. Here’s an in-depth look at the prediction, team form, news, and potential outcomes of this highly anticipated clash.

Current Form and Recent Performance

Rosario

Rosario Central, under the guidance of Miguel Angel Russo, has experienced a rocky campaign so far.

They currently sit third in Group G with four points, following a 1-0 home defeat to Atletico Mineiro. This loss marked their third successive match conceding the opening goal in the group stage.

Despite a strong start with a win against Penarol, Rosario has struggled, remaining winless in their last six matches across all competitions.

Their attacking woes are evident, having scored just one first-half goal in the group stage.

Caracas FC

On the other hand, Caracas FC, the 12-time champions of Venezuela, have had an even tougher time.

They are at the bottom of Group G with only one point, having lost their last match 1-0 to Penarol. Domestically, they are also floundering, positioned 12th in the Apertura.

Caracas has not secured a competitive victory since February, highlighting their struggles both defensively and offensively. They have allowed 11 goals in four Libertadores matches, more than any other team in the tournament.

Team News and Lineups

Rosario will be missing Francis Mac Allister and Agustin Bravo due to ACL injuries, while Abel Hernandez is out with a thigh injury.

Newcomers Jonatan Gomez and Agustin Modica could start, having replaced Lautaro Giaccone and Tobias Cervera in the previous match.

Caracas, managed by Henry Melendez, may feature Frankarlos Benitez, Luis Casiani, and Manuel Sulbaran in the starting lineup.

Edwuin Pernia and Danny Perez, the only goal scorers for Caracas in this competition, are expected to lead the attack.

Prediction

Given the current form and historical performances, Rosario Central is favoured to win this match.

They have never lost to a Venezuelan opponent in the Copa Libertadores and have a stronger defensive record compared to Caracas.

Our predicted scoreline is Rosario Central 2-0 Caracas, with Rosario likely to capitalise on Caracas’ defensive vulnerabilities and their own home advantage.
